I, too, have seen this problem. I think it has to do with either a removable
drive or a pending CD-write to a XP folder (do you have a CD-RW?).

This is what worked for me:

Reboot the machine and see if you still get it (after removing all CD's). If
that doesn't work, reboot the machine, uninstall RR2.0 (and any other
version of 2.0 beta) and reinstall. That should do the trick.

I have installed Rev 2.0 on Win2k and MacOSX with good results. However, My
Windows XP installation is not usable because the following error repeatedly
pops up as a prompt window.

"Insert disk into drive \Device\Harddisk1\DR3."

Has anyone else seen this on Windows XP or know of a solution?
